Offers great protection, but heavy
As with most Fintie cases I have purchased over the years for my Kindles, they offer great protection, are well made and very competitively priced. It's hard to find fault with this case, it offers fantastic protection, very sturdy and well made. BUT sadly it's simply too heavy for hand holding whilst reading (I mean really heavy!). If you are doing a lot travelling / commuting with your Scribe, this case offers truly superb protection. But if you are just using your Scribe for reading around the house, you'll most likely find this case a little heavy and fatiguing.

Heavy yet fragile
The case has been falling apart for weeks already and I've not had it very long. The magnets that close it came out, so I glued those back in, only for the plastic housing next to the magnets to break off next. The case is very heavy, though also seems quite sturdy as a result, its just a shame the production quality is so low that its breaking up.

I purchased two of these Fintie Slimshell Cases—one for my 10.2" Kindle Scribe (2022 release) and another for the 2024 release. This case fits both versions perfectly, with a snug and secure hold. The "Composition Book" design is a clever touch, and I appreciate how it disguises my Kindle as an ordinary notebook. It’s a great way to avoid drawing attention while out in public. The auto wake/sleep function is incredibly convenient. Opening the case instantly wakes up the Kindle, and closing it puts it to sleep, saving battery life effortlessly. Despite its slim and lightweight profile, this case provides excellent protection. I've accidentally dropped my Kindle a couple of times, and it has remained fully functional—no scratches or damage, which speaks to the case's durability. While the Kindle Scribe has a magnetic mount for the pen, I prefer using the built-in pen holder on this case. The pen fits snugly, making it less likely to get lost. The quality of the materials is impressive; the case feels premium and well-made. It offers great value for the price and is an essential accessory for any Kindle Scribe owner. J**R
I used to have the trust to Fintie products. Value for money. But not this time. Initially, all good, very esthetic case and it is has the loop of the pen separately on top, not embedded into plastic case. Although, magnets quickly losen up. They fall off the place where they are placed. And after carrying Kindle in the work backpack, I used to find magnets sticking to cover, on top. At the end, I lost one. Then, plastic quality... I don't pull out Kindle form the case. I don't throw it on anything hard. But, it somehow breaks! It breaks on the corners, edges. Like the tension of the kindle placement makes the plastic weak with the time? I bought the case in May 2024, it is broken by January 2025.
